单词 a gauge of
例句
原声例句
经济学人(汇总)

A second use of tweets is as a gauge of economic conditions.

推特帖子的第二个用途是作为经济状况的衡量标准。

NPR音讯 2013年1月合集

A gauge of future economic activity in the US suggests strong growth in the month ahead.

衡量未来美国经济活动的强劲增长已经近在眼前。

经济学人-财经

A gauge of financial conditions compiled by Bloomberg, a data provider, has shown them steadily loosening.

数据提供者彭博社对金融环境的衡量数据显示,金融环境正在稳步放松。

经济学人(汇总)

Many of America's biggest companies, including McDonald's, report a negative book value, a gauge of a firm's net assets.

包括麦当劳在内的很多美国最大公司上报的账面价值都是负值,账面价值是对一家公司净资产的估量。

经济学人(汇总)

But unless the government concedes that the size of HSBC's global balance-sheet is not a gauge of its risk to Britain, HSBC will worry that its size is capped.

但是除非政府认同汇丰的全球资产负债表的规模并非是衡量其带给英国风险大小的标准,汇丰还是会担心其规模达到上限。
